## Deployment

CrashFunnel ingests mobile crash reports via the edge collector, symbolicates them in isolated workers, and writes results to the Ember store. Deploy with the standard rollout script; canary at 5% for one hour before promoting. Reviewers should confirm retention and scrubbing settings match the values listed directly below.

config for kajef-hahof:
[ulamir]
port = 5672
region = central-1
host = ulamir.lumicsys.corp
timeout_ms = 2000
retries = 3

Ticket: Tilegrab prefetcher over-fetches zoom 14 tiles on the Harborline map view. Cache hit rate dropped from 91% to 63% after Tuesday's deploy. Suspect the bounding-box math in the pan handler. Repro: pan quickly across the Velden district demo dataset. Fix owned by the Cartwheel squad, targeting Friday. Trace the regression against the build stamped below.

pipeline stamp: htk31_f769b577b3028a4e9958e5bb8d1259a

## Runbook: Addressly autocomplete acting up

If customers say the address autocomplete widget on Fernbrook checkout is showing stale or empty suggestions, don't panic — it's usually the suggestion cache. First, check the widget health page; if latency is over a second, the upstream geo index is probably reindexing. You can safely bump the cache TTL down and force a refresh without a deploy. Escalate to the Maps Guild only if errors persist past 30 minutes. The widget reads its settings from the values below.

config for tajof-kawep:
[aldius]
port = 3000
region = lower-2
host = aldius.plorvasoft.example
team = eliius
timeout_ms = 750
retries = 6

## Deploy step 4: Brushcutter bot

Brushcutter sweeps stale branches older than 60 days in the Fernbase monorepo. After pulling the image, set `SWEEP_SCHEDULE` (cron syntax) and `DRY_RUN=true` for your first rollout — trust us on that one. The bot needs permission to delete branches, so it reads a token from the environment; add this line to the env file now.

secret setting of yajog-taguf: ARCHIVE_KEY3=051